            <title>A new HAI WORLD of sorts</title>
            <link>http://feeds.lolcode.com/~r/lolcode/~3/c0Ce3IMbmok/a-new-hai-world</link>
            <description>&lt;h1&gt;&lt;a name="a-new-hai-world-of-sorts" id="a-new-hai-world-of-sorts"&gt;A new HAI WORLD of sorts&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;
&lt;div class="level1"&gt;

&lt;p&gt;

Reddit has been infected by this meme of “A Reddit clone in X lines of Y programming language.” I suppose, then, that it was inevitable that someone would pull it off with &lt;a href="http://www.reddit.com/r/programming/comments/b0hi4" class="urlextern" title="http://www.reddit.com/r/programming/comments/b0hi4"  rel="nofollow"&gt; LOLCODE&lt;/a&gt;. Naturally, as with any high performance web programming needs, they turned to &lt;acronym title="Hypertext Preprocessor"&gt;PHP&lt;/acronym&gt;, and &lt;a href="http://www.tetraboy.com/lolcode/" class="urlextern" title="http://www.tetraboy.com/lolcode/"  rel="nofollow"&gt;Tetraboy&amp;#039;s LOLCODE implementation&lt;/a&gt;, which was one of the very first out there (and why it might not look like other dialects of LOLCODE found elsewhere). 
&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;pre class="code"&gt;CAN HAS SQL?
DBASE IZ GETDB(&amp;#039;db/lcsn.db&amp;#039;)
FUNNAHS IZ DBUCKET(&amp;amp;DBASE&amp;amp;,&amp;quot;CAN I PLZ GET * ALL UP IN lollit&amp;quot;)
IM IN UR FUNNAHS ITZA TITLE
	VOTEZ IZ &amp;amp;TITLE#ups&amp;amp; - &amp;amp;TITLE#downs&amp;amp;
...
&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
Well played, &lt;a href="http://www.reddit.com/user/keyz182" class="urlextern" title="http://www.reddit.com/user/keyz182"  rel="nofollow"&gt;keyz182&lt;/a&gt;, well played.

            <title>PL/LOLCODE</title>
            <link>http://feeds.lolcode.com/~r/lolcode/~3/XK8mLoaIHw4/lolcode</link>
            <description>&lt;h1&gt;&lt;a name="pllolcode" id="pllolcode"&gt;PL/LOLCODE&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;
&lt;div class="level1"&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
I&amp;#039;ve mentioned Josh “Eggyknap” Tolley&amp;#039;s adventures with LOLCODE in PostgreSQL before, but never really gave him the spotlight. About a week ago, he presented his work at &lt;a href="http://postgresqlconference.org/west08/" class="urlextern" title="http://postgresqlconference.org/west08/"  rel="nofollow"&gt;PostgreSQL Conference: West&lt;/a&gt; about a week ago. LOLCODE once again proves its worth as a “HAI WORLD” language for language implementors, as Josh&amp;#039;s 90-minute presentation was a tutorial on how to implement a procedural language for PostgreSQL.
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
&lt;iframe src='http://docs.google.com/EmbedSlideshow?docid=df9t2m5q_13gzzxhdc8' frameborder='0' width='466' height='360'&gt;&lt;/iframe&gt;
The entertaining and informative slides are &lt;a href="http://eggyknap.blogspot.com/2008/10/pllolcode-howto.html" class="urlextern" title="http://eggyknap.blogspot.com/2008/10/pllolcode-howto.html"  rel="nofollow"&gt;here&lt;/a&gt;, and there&amp;#039;s a bonus program listing telling you &lt;a href="http://eggyknap.blogspot.com/2008/10/calculating-pi-in-lolcode.html" class="urlextern" title="http://eggyknap.blogspot.com/2008/10/calculating-pi-in-lolcode.html"  rel="nofollow"&gt;how to calculate pi&lt;/a&gt;.
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
Thanks, Josh, and congrats on a job well done!

            <title>State of the LOLs</title>
            <link>http://feeds.lolcode.com/~r/lolcode/~3/LmI7FLw4c8E/state-of-the-lols</link>
            <description>&lt;h1&gt;&lt;a name="state-of-the-lols" id="state-of-the-lols"&gt;State of the LOLs&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;
&lt;div class="level1"&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
&lt;a href="http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/159240409X?ie=UTF8&amp;amp;tag=recomme-20&amp;amp;linkCode=as2&amp;amp;camp=1789&amp;amp;creative=9325&amp;amp;creativeASIN=159240409X" class="media" title="http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/159240409X?ie=UTF8&amp;amp;tag=recomme-20&amp;amp;linkCode=as2&amp;amp;camp=1789&amp;amp;creative=9325&amp;amp;creativeASIN=159240409X"  rel="nofollow"&gt;&lt;img src="http://lolcode.com/lib/exe/fetch.php?w=&amp;amp;h=&amp;amp;cache=cache&amp;amp;media=http%3A%2F%2Fecx.images-amazon.com%2Fimages%2FI%2F61MZBG2KM5L._SL500_AA240_.jpg" class="medialeft" align="left" title="I Can Has Cheezburger? at amazon.com" alt="I Can Has Cheezburger? at amazon.com"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;
It&amp;#039;s been a while since I did a roundup of the memes, and there&amp;#039;s some news to spread, so I may as well get down to it. 
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
I recently received a pre-release version of the much talked-about LOLCats book. I learned that it was in production back at &lt;a href="http://roflcon.org/" class="urlextern" title="http://roflcon.org/"  rel="nofollow"&gt;ROFLCon&lt;/a&gt;, and the team who originated &lt;a href="http://icanhascheezburger.com/" class="urlextern" title="http://icanhascheezburger.com/"  rel="nofollow"&gt;ICHC&lt;/a&gt; created it as a labor of love. It&amp;#039;s really cleverly compiled. In addition to the cat macros we all know and love, there are numerous, cute, effective illustrations that help stitch things together. The illustrations also serve, in some cases, to mask the poor image resolution of the originals where higher-res images couldn&amp;#039;t be found. In this way, some classics (e.g., ceiling cat &amp;amp; monorail cat) are able to make it into the book when they might have been excluded.
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
The book is a nice keepsake for those of us who are deeply into the LOLs, but where it really shines is as a gift to those relatives who are not so much into online culture. I know I have to get a copy for my cat-crazy aunt. The LOLCats in the book are fairly dominated by the “Tofuburger” end of things: popular, cute, and not too obscure. Geek classics are also in there (passing it around to officemates got a lot of guffaws from quantum cat), so you can use the book as a gateway drug for the LOLs. It&amp;#039;s really well produced, with full-color, full-bleed printing throughout. 
&lt;/p&gt;

            <title>A different sort of Twitter bot</title>
            <link>http://feeds.lolcode.com/~r/lolcode/~3/yVGSN-tYnlI/twitter-bot</link>
            <description>&lt;h1&gt;&lt;a name="a-different-sort-of-twitter-bot" id="a-different-sort-of-twitter-bot"&gt;A different sort of Twitter bot&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;
&lt;div class="level1"&gt;

&lt;p&gt;

&lt;a href="http://recom.me/" class="media" title="http://recom.me/"  rel="nofollow"&gt;&lt;img src="http://lolcode.com/lib/exe/fetch.php?w=&amp;amp;h=&amp;amp;cache=cache&amp;amp;media=http%3A%2F%2Frecom.me%2Fstatic%2Frecomme-logo-med.png" class="mediaright" align="right" title="recom.me" alt="recom.me"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;
I&amp;#039;ve long held a strong fascination for Twitter in conjunction with LOLCODE. Twitter was pretty much the first vector for people to hear about LOLCODE on its first day, before Reddit and Digg struck. I also thought that LOLCODE would make a good language for a bot running on Twitter: if people could access it via SMS, and it looks close to TXT SPEEK anyway, it could be a compelling combination. That never materialized, but the idea stuck around.
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
My latest project has been a music recommendation agent for Twitter. Yes, Twitter bots are so 2007, but I&amp;#039;d like to think that &lt;a href="http://recom.me/" class="urlextern" title="http://recom.me/"  rel="nofollow"&gt;recom.me&lt;/a&gt; brings something new to the table by giving user queries some persistence. Not only does the bot react on Twitter, but it creates a permanent &lt;acronym title="Uniform Resource Locator"&gt;URL&lt;/acronym&gt; on its own website.
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
If you like music and have some tolerance for Twitter, please check the user &lt;a href="http://twitter.com/recomme" class="urlextern" title="http://twitter.com/recomme"  rel="nofollow"&gt;@recomme&lt;/a&gt; out, and send it a band name or solo artist. It should respond within a couple minutes with a list of other, similar musicians worth checking out. Respond again with “more” (or, if you prefer, “MOAR”), it&amp;#039;ll send a few more artists to consider. I designed it to be easy to use via SMS at, say, the record store.

            <title>LOLBush</title>
            <link>http://feeds.lolcode.com/~r/lolcode/~3/TKho35IQKI8/lolbush</link>
            <description>&lt;h1&gt;&lt;a name="lolbush" id="lolbush"&gt;LOLBush&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;
&lt;div class="level1"&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
&lt;a href="http://www.guardian.co.uk/world/gallery/2008/aug/12/bushlol?picture=336501036" class="media" title="http://www.guardian.co.uk/world/gallery/2008/aug/12/bushlol?picture=336501036"  rel="nofollow"&gt;&lt;img src="http://lolcode.com/lib/exe/fetch.php?w=&amp;amp;h=&amp;amp;cache=cache&amp;amp;media=http%3A%2F%2Flolcode.com%2Flib%2Fimages%2Flolbush-ipod.jpg" class="mediacenter" title="i can has iPod?" alt="i can has iPod?"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
Some of you will already have come across this &lt;a href="http://blogs.guardian.co.uk/usa/2008/08/lol_bush.html" class="urlextern" title="http://blogs.guardian.co.uk/usa/2008/08/lol_bush.html"  rel="nofollow"&gt;political commentary&lt;/a&gt; from the Guardian, highlighting some of George W. Bush&amp;#039;s adventures in China during the Olympics.
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;
Seeing this go through a mainstream (not technology) editorial flow (even if it appears to be online-only) seems to mark a new point in the development of LOLCats. I&amp;#039;ve known the Guardian Technology folks to be very hip to &lt;a href="http://flickr.com/photos/atl/2450307998/" class="urlextern" title="http://flickr.com/photos/atl/2450307998/"  rel="nofollow"&gt;all things LOL&lt;/a&gt;, but this is mainstream coverage that goes beyond “Oh, look at those wacky geeks and their wacky humor.” It pretty much assumes you know what image macros are, or at least will find them funny on their own. LOLCats are entering the vernacular.
